Refactor WebRenderer to use server-side streaming with OGG-FLAC sink
This commit refactors the WebRenderer to use a server-side streaming architecture with OGG-FLAC sink instead of the previous WebSocket-based approach. The changes include: - Replaced WebSocket communication with HTTP streaming using DirectOggFlacSink - Implemented a new pipeline architecture with dedicated handlers for UPnP commands - Added new modules for registration, registry, and streaming - Updated the renderer to work with a pipeline control system - Removed old WebSocket session management - Added support for HTTP streaming with gapless playback - Updated dependencies and features for the new architecture The WebRenderer now acts as a MediaRenderer UPnP device that serves audio streams via HTTP endpoints, with commands relayed to the audio pipeline through a new control system.
